To my regret, I returned the grey animal print dress

When I got back from my trip, my package with the dress was there. I opened it. Tried it on.

beautiful materal, the fit was wonderful, loved the pleat in the front. However, that SEAM down the top of the dress and with the print being mismatched horribly with that seam, I couldn't wear it. It would haunt me - lol

I do not understand why this dress, with the way it is cut and put together, had to have a SEAM that went down the front of the top. So disappointed, as I loved everything else about this dress, but that was a dealbreaker for me. Perhaps it was the one I got, but the print was not matching up - I understand that prints don't line up, but to have it done in such an obvious place (not the side, but the front) was just a bad design move, imho

btw - I couldn't watch it live, because I was leaving that morning for my trip. And the pictures don't really show the seam being so obvious - in fact, when I relooked at the pics on the item, I didn't even notice the seam until I zoomed in and looked for it. I would not have known to look for one at all when that pic came up.

oh well. If this dress comes out in a solid charcoal grey or black, I would purchase it in a heartbeat. I just think that with the print, it is a krapshoot on what you will get.
